Latest Patents

Wakatsuki holds a patent for a unique type of colored glass. This glass features a surface that is roughened either in whole or in part. The patent specifies that the average gloss value, measured at nine points on the surface at an incident angle of 60 degrees, is 30 or less. Additionally, the patent outlines that the ratio of the difference between the maximum and minimum gloss values to the maximum gloss value is 20% or less. Furthermore, the minimum visible-light transmittance at a thickness of 0.8 mm is 70% or less. This innovation represents a significant step forward in the design and functionality of colored glass.
